17#include <gtest/gtest.h>
18
19#include <errno.h>
20#include <signal.h>
21
22template <typename Fn>
23static void TestSigSet1(Fn fn) {
24 // NULL sigset_t*.
25 sigset_t* set_ptr = NULL;
26 errno = 0;
27 ASSERT_EQ(-1, fn(set_ptr));
28 ASSERT_EQ(EINVAL, errno);
29
30 // Non-NULL.
31 sigset_t set;
32 errno = 0;
33 ASSERT_EQ(0, fn(&set));
34 ASSERT_EQ(0, errno);
35}
36
37template <typename Fn>
38static void TestSigSet2(Fn fn) {
39 // NULL sigset_t*.
40 sigset_t* set_ptr = NULL;
41 errno = 0;
42 ASSERT_EQ(-1, fn(set_ptr, SIGSEGV));
43 ASSERT_EQ(EINVAL, errno);
44
45 sigset_t set;
46 sigemptyset(&set);
47
48 int min_signal = SIGHUP;
49 int max_signal = SIGRTMAX;
50
51#if __BIONIC__
52 // bionic's sigset_t is too small: 32 bits instead of 64.
53 // This means you can't refer to any of the real-time signals.
54 // See http://b/3038348 and http://b/5828899.
55 max_signal = 31;
56#else
57 // Other C libraries are perfectly capable of using their largest signal.
58 ASSERT_GE(sizeof(sigset_t) * 8, static_cast<size_t>(SIGRTMAX));
59#endif
60
61 // Bad signal number: too small.
62 errno = 0;
63 ASSERT_EQ(-1, fn(&set, 0));
64 ASSERT_EQ(EINVAL, errno);
65
66 // Bad signal number: too high.
67 errno = 0;
68 ASSERT_EQ(-1, fn(&set, max_signal + 1));
69 ASSERT_EQ(EINVAL, errno);
70
71 // Good signal numbers, low and high ends of range.
72 errno = 0;
73 ASSERT_EQ(0, fn(&set, min_signal));
74 ASSERT_EQ(0, errno);
75 ASSERT_EQ(0, fn(&set, max_signal));
76 ASSERT_EQ(0, errno);
77}
78
79TEST(signal, sigismember_invalid) {
80 TestSigSet2(sigismember);
81}
82
83TEST(signal, sigaddset_invalid) {
84 TestSigSet2(sigaddset);
85}
86
87TEST(signal, sigdelset_invalid) {
88 TestSigSet2(sigdelset);
89}
90
91TEST(signal, sigemptyset_invalid) {
92 TestSigSet1(sigemptyset);
93}
94
95TEST(signal, sigfillset_invalid) {
96 TestSigSet1(sigfillset);
97}
